The Position

The Vice President, Business Affairs will be primarily responsible for the deals related to the development and production of scripted programming for the entertainment television and streaming platforms at NBCUniversal – the NBC broadcast network, the Bravo, E!, Oxygen, Syfy, UniKids and USA cable networks and the Peacock streaming service. The role will include, but not be limited to, working with the internal NBCU studios, negotiating deals with third party studios, and handling various aspects of scripted programming from the perspective of the buying platform. Responsibilities shall also include deals related to product integration and the exploitation of digital media rights. This individual will report to the Executive Vice President, Business Affairs.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
• Negotiate all aspects of scripted programming deals with third party studios
• Interface with the following departments on a day-to-day basis: creative, legal, publicity, finance, ad sales, marketing, and digital
• Handle and resolve intercompany issues within NBCUniversal, including working closely with Business Affairs for the Universal Studio Group in the negotiation of deals
• Review budgets and other financial data associated with the development and production of aforesaid programming.
• Draft short-form deal memos as well as review long-form agreements for accuracy of terms negotiated and coordination of payment authorizations.

Qualifications/Requirements
The Person
• 10+ years of business and/or legal affairs experience at a large law firm or media company
• Prior experience negotiating scripted television deals on behalf of broadcast and/or cable networks and streaming platforms
• JD and active member of the California State Bar
